牛津词典
noun
- (启动新项目的)开支,费用
the money that you have to spend in order to start a new project- The business quickly repaid the initial outlay on advertising.
这家公司很快偿付了初期的广告费。 - a massive financial/capital outlay
大量的财政 / 资本开支

柯林斯词典
- N-VAR (必要的)费用,开支
Outlayis the amount of money that you have to spend in order to buy something or start a project.- Apart from the capital outlay of buying the machine, dishwashers can actually save you money...
除了购置所用开支,洗碗机实际上能为你省钱。 - A beginner could really enjoy the hobby for an outlay of between £100 or £120 a month.
初学者只需每月花上100到120英镑便能真正享受到这种爱好带来的乐趣。
